Xiwu Zhao has authored 23 papers that have received a total of 524 indexed citations.
This includes 11 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 10 papers in Molecular Biology and 8 papers in Endocrine and Autonomic Systems. The topics of these papers are Retinal Development and Disorders (8 papers), Circadian rhythm and melatonin (8 papers) and Photoreceptor and optogenetics research (7 papers). Xiwu Zhao is often cited by papers focused on Retinal Development and Disorders (8 papers), Circadian rhythm and melatonin (8 papers) and Photoreceptor and optogenetics research (7 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and Brazil. Xiwu Zhao's co-authors include Kwoon Y. Wong, Andrew P. Chervenak, Tongjun Gu, Aaron N. Reifler and Dapeng Yu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Journal of Neuroscience and PLoS ONE.
